Sign In — Free (10 views/day)ZION INSTITUTE, founded in 2003, is a small nonprofit in the Human Services sector that reported $669K in total revenue in fiscal year 2024. Revenue fell 61% from the prior year — a significant decline worth monitoring. Expenses of $771K exceeded revenue, resulting in a 15% operating deficit.
ZION'S MOST SIGNIFICANT ACTIVITIES INCLUDE EARLY CHILDHOOD EDUCATION PROGRAMS, INTEGRATED HEALTH SERVICES, FAMILY PRESERVATION SERVICES, AND FOSTER CARE PROVIDER LICENSING. IT IS OUR ENDEAVOR TO BUILD HEALTHY CHILDREN, FAMILIES AND COMMUNITIES.
